About

  • Born in Chattanooga, Tennessee, Mr. Brown has practiced with the firm since 2002 and has been a Equity Member of the firm since 2008
  • He concentrates his practice in the areas of workers' compensation and general liability defense, primarily premises and auto liability
  • He also has a background in defense of governmental entities, having formerly served as Assistant City Attorney for the City of Knoxville, Tennessee
